The superficial liposculpture technique enables you to achieve better results in body and facial contouring than are possible with conventional methods since the dissection is done in the superficial compartment, close under the skin, instead of in the deep layers of the subcutaneous tissue. In this book you will find out about the technique as perfected by the authors. They especially discuss the syringe as an improved vacuum source, secondary liposuction and problems following previous liposuction and new advances in the treatment of cellulite. Large chapters are devoted to contour augmentation and total liposculpture. The authors have set new standards that surpass previous teaching and practice. Liposuction is a procedure in cosmetic surgery that breaks up excess body fat, which is then removed through a cannula inserted under the skin. Atlas of Liposuction is a comprehensive guide to the current techniques for liposuction. Beginning with an introduction to the history and set up of the procedure, the following chapters discuss liposuction in different parts of the body and post-operative management. Each procedure is described in a step by step manner, detailing incisions, positions, instruments, anaesthesia, preoperative care and the actual operative technique. Written by highly experienced plastic surgeons from California, this exhaustive atlas features nearly 740 full colour photographs and illustrations showing actual clinical cases. This unique book details advanced techniques in lipoplasty and autologous fat grafting for high-definition body sculpting. Clear step-by-step explanations of techniques are accompanied by numerous color illustrations and photographs. The first section includes chapters on surface and muscular anatomy, anesthesia, assessment, technologies for ultrasound-assisted lipoplasty, and postoperative care. High-definition sculpting of the male and female abdomen, trunk, back, chest, and upper and lower limbs is then described in detail, and clear instruction is provided on autologous fat grafting for contouring the buttocks, breasts, and pectoral areas.
